  7. Feb 13, 2020 · Total reported sales increased by 1.2% to CHF 92.6 billion (2018: CHF 91.4 billion). Net acquisitions had a negative impact of 0.8% and foreign exchange reduced sales by 1.5%. One year ahead of Nestlé's medium-term plan, the company reached its 2020 profitability target range.
